The Generation Why Podcast

The Generation Why Podcast


Barbara Jean Horn - 565

April 14, 2024

July 12, 1988. Philadelphia, Pennsylvania. In the summer of 1988, 4-year-old Barbara Jean Horn went missing from her home in Philadelphia PA. Last seen holding hands with an unknown man, she was later found dead, beaten and bloodied, in a TV box two block